How they compare
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of currently reports 10.5 deaths per 100,000 people against 9.85 deaths per 100,000 people in Thailand, a difference of 0.65 deaths per 100,000 people.
That makes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of's figure about 1.1 times Thailand's.
Across all 41 years both countries report,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of has been ahead every year.
Thailand ranks 40th and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of ranks 38th of 111 countries.
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Thailand |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1.13 deaths per 100,000 people | 6.89 deaths per 100,000 people | 5.76 deaths per 100,000 people |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of |
| 1970s | 1.54 deaths per 100,000 people | 7.77 deaths per 100,000 people | 6.23 deaths per 100,000 people |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of |
| 1980s | 2.05 deaths per 100,000 people | 8 deaths per 100,000 people | 5.95 deaths per 100,000 people |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of |
| 1990s | 3.18 deaths per 100,000 people | 10.04 deaths per 100,000 people | 6.87 deaths per 100,000 people |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of |
| 2000s | 7.28 deaths per 100,000 people | 10.71 deaths per 100,000 people | 3.43 deaths per 100,000 people |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of |
| 2010s | 9.48 deaths per 100,000 people | 10.92 deaths per 100,000 people | 1.44 deaths per 100,000 people |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
